A dog harness is a vital piece of equipment for many dogs around the world. It provides a safe way to secure your dog to leash, without having to use a collar.
Well, collars are a fine for some, but many dogs have a serious problem of choking when they are wearing one. Unfortunately, this force can cause neck pain, trachea damage, breathing issues, and gagging.
The beauty in the design of the dog harness is that it wraps around your dogs torso, allowing any pulling force to be evenly distributed across their body. Once you’ve made the choice to own a harness for your dog, you must go shopping for one. Shopping for a dog harness is pretty easy, however there are a few things you should be sure to look for.
Dog Harness are made in all different sizes to fit dogs of all weight. Some types may have one latch, others may have two, or it might be a step in harness, without any latches. While most dogs enjoy wearing a dg harness, some may be hesitant at first. If your dog doesn’t like their dog harness, try giving them a treat.

As a dog owner, you only want the best for your pet. That’s why when you’re out looking for the best dog harness, make sure that you have a clear picture of the best. Here are some guidelines for you:
- Look for a Soft Material.
You wouldn’t like your dog to feel uneasy or uncomfortable every time his neck or chest gets rubbed against the dog harness. That’s why it’s always a good idea to stick with the soft style dog harness, especially those that are made of fine mesh, nylon, or suede.
- Durability.
You want a dog harness that would give you a good return on your investment, which means you can use it for many years.
- Easy to maintain.
You don’t want to spend a lot of time cleaning and drying the dog harness. As much as possible, the dog harness must be just wash and wear.
- Relieve neck strain.
This is perhaps the most advantageous use of a dog harness. The kind of soft dog harness that you decide on should have the capacity to remove the weight of the dog from the neck and distribute it through his shoulders.
